共查询到19条相似文献,搜索用时 78 毫秒
1.
根据分支指令的特性,分析了分支行为与分支预测技术对单发射嵌入式处理器CPI栈(CPI stacks)组成的影响,并在RTL级设计了分支预测器的时序精确模型,通过硬件模拟方法对分支指令特性和分支预测器的性能进行了研究.实验考察了分支指令在分支预测器命中或缺失时的不同跳转统计特性,验证了分支预测器对CPI栈影响的理论推导,为单发射嵌入式处理器中分支预测器的设计与优化提供了精确的实验依据. 相似文献
2.
一种gshare分支预测器的低功耗设计方法 总被引:1,自引:3,他引:1
功耗与性能在高端嵌入武计算系统中都是非常重要的设计指标。基于深度流水处理器中所使用的动态分支预测器的微结构特点,提出了一种利用分页技术来有效的降低gshare分支预测器的功耗的设计方法,详细分析了分支预测器的大小、分页数以及功耗、面积之间的内在关系。 相似文献
3.
"龙腾R"是西北工业大学自主研制的32位高性能微处理器.该处理器的分支处理单元(BPU)能有效降低控制相关带来的延迟.通过分析已有的分支方向预测算法和分支目标地址预测策略,在分支处理单元总体约束下,合理分配分支方向预测和目标地址预测的实现代价,提出了一种基于混合分支预测器和经过改进的目标地址缓冲(grB)结构的分支处理单元结构.该结构不仅比传统的由gshare分支方向预测器构成的分支处理单元预测准确率平均高出1%~2%,并具有面积小、功耗低的特点. 相似文献
4.
5.
ARM嵌入式处理器与嵌入式系统 总被引:9,自引:0,他引:9
本刊最近对全国大学生电子设计竞赛“嵌入式系统”专题竞赛进行了报道,引起了一些读者的兴趣,但很多读者不了解Strong ARM到底是怎么回事,本刊特邀请《单片机与嵌入式系统应用》杂志编委马忠梅老师就ARM嵌入式处理器与嵌入式系统的情况做一介绍。 相似文献
6.
嵌入式处理器嵌入式系统的心脏 总被引:2,自引:0,他引:2
一、嵌入式处理器分类与现状 嵌入式系统的核心部件是各种类型的嵌入式处理器,据不完全统计,目前全世界嵌入式处理器的品种总量已经超过1000多种,流行体系结构有30几个系列,其中8051体系的占有多半。生产8051单片机的半导体厂家有20多个,共350多种衍生产品,仅Philips就有近100种。现在 相似文献
7.
8.
利用阵列乘法器中的压缩部分积的思想,通过对传统的串行执行乘法器的改造,提出了一种带压缩器的串行执行浮点乘法器,分析了具有不同压缩模块结构的乘法器的性能.实验表明,该乘法器可以有效地提高传统的串行乘法器的性能,而面积要小于阵列乘法器. 相似文献
9.
10.
多模基带处理器芯片的设计已成为研究的热点。文章结合无线通信处理算法的特点.利用指令级加速技术,设计了一种基于无线通信中复数运算的16位嵌入式处理器核。利用它可以通过灵活的配置软件完成基带处理中绝大部分的复数相关运算和控制功能。经实际流片测试,该处理器核具有面积小、功耗低的特点.可用于多模无线通信基带处理器的设计。 相似文献
11.
12.
随着电子技术的迅猛发展,具有耗电少、亮度高、体积小等特点的LCD(液晶显示器)被广泛应用于嵌入式系统中。S3C2410是三星公司开发的一款以ARM920T为核心的16/32位嵌入式处理器。它主要面向手持设备以及高性价比、低功耗的应用。文中介绍了三星公司设计的ARM920T嵌入式处理器$3C2410在PDA(个人数字助理)硬件设计电路中的应用。详细提供了PDA的LCD、触摸屏及键盘等人机接口模块的设计电路。该设计技术先进,结构合理,功能较完备,整体性、可扩充性强。 相似文献
13.
14.
This paper proposes a software pipelining framework, CALiBeR (ClusterAware Load Balancing Retiming Algorithm), suitable for compilers targetingclustered embedded VLIW processors. CALiBeR can be used by embedded systemdesigners to explore different code optimization alternatives, that is, high-qualitycustomized retiming solutions for desired throughput and program memory sizerequirements, while minimizing register pressure. An extensive set of experimentalresults is presented, demonstrating that our algorithm compares favorablywith one of the best state-of-the-art algorithms, achieving up to 50% improvementin performance and up to 47% improvement in register requirements. In orderto empirically assess the effectiveness of clustering for high ILP applications,additional experiments are presented contrasting the performance achievedby software pipelined kernels executing on clustered and on centralized machines. 相似文献
15.
嵌入式系统设计时由于成本和功耗等方面的考虑而较少重视安全性,而一般采用的软件防御方式无法满足嵌入式系统在实时性和可靠性上的要求,缓冲区溢出作为最常见的软件安全漏洞对嵌入式系统安全构成严重威胁.文中构建了一种基于细粒度指令流监控(FIFM)的硬件防御机制,通过虚拟执行单元虚拟执行程序,在攻击发生之前检测攻击行为.实验结果表明FIFM能很好的防御典型的缓冲区溢出攻击,而且FIFM不需要修改程序,不破坏流水线完整性,对系统的性能影响小,本文的防护机制可以应用于其他嵌入式系统设计中以动态防御缓冲区溢出攻击. 相似文献
16.
本文先介绍了分支线正交定向耦合器的概念与工作原理;然后根据该原理在ADS2009软件下设计仿真了工作在Ka波段的微带线定向耦合器,并对Ka波段的耦合器模型进行了改良,使之实际面积缩小的同时能达到原有的性能。 相似文献
17.
18.
19.
介绍了一种为T RIC快速开发高级语言编译工具的方法.LCC是一个小型的可变目标C语言编译器,通过扩展LCC后端使其支持硬件中断等嵌入式C语言语法特性,进而实现 T RIC的C语言编译器.经测试验证,此方法可大大降低移植LCC的难度和出错的概率,且能快速开发出目标处理器的编译工具. 相似文献